Former Manchester United and Real Madrid player David Beckham’s wife, Victoria Beckham, has told how she
feels about people who mocked the midfielder for the red card he received in the 1998 World Cup against Argentina.

In the 47th minute of the 1/8 final match, the Englishman was sent off for a foul on Diego Simeone.
‘I can tell you about utter hatred and public ridicule. David was depressed, clinically depressed.
I still want to kill those people,’ the former Spice Girls singer said in the Netflix documentary Beckham.
The match between Argentina and England ended with a score of 2:2, and the Albiceleste was stronger in the penalty shootout.
